Sometimes a student needs access to a Blackboard module ahead of the date when the rest of the class will see the content. Here are instructions on setting early access for a student.

How to Allow a Single Student to Open a Lesson Early

Step 1: Add Adaptive Release for Early Access

  1. Navigate to Lessons Homepage, and click on the module's action link
  2. Click Adaptive Release: Advanced
  3. Create Rule
  4. Change Rule Name to "Exception", click Submit
  5. Create Criteria --> Membership
  6. Browse, select student, click Submit
  7. When you return to the previous page, the student name(s) will appear in the Username box
  8. Click Submit at bottom right
  9. Click OK at bottom right

Step 2: Add Adaptive Release Rule for Normal Access

Continuing from the steps above...
  1. Create Rule
  2. Change Rule Name to "Normal", click Submit
  3. Create Criteria --> Date
  4. Check the Display After box and set the date and time to open the module to the rest of the class
  5. Click Submit at bottom right
  6. Click OK at bottom right
You will be returned to the Adaptive Release: Advanced summary page for this module, where you can see the two rules with the OR condition applied. This means access to the module is granted to anyone named in the "Exception" rule OR access to the module is granted when the date criteria of the "Normal" rule is met.

Step 3: Remove Existing Availability Dates

You will also need to remove any current Availability Date set in the module options. To do this,  return to Lessons homepage and click on the module's action link
  1. Click Edit (the top option in the list)
  2. Scroll down to STANDARD OPTIONS -> Select Date and Time Restrictions and make sure the box next to Display After is NOT checked.

Optional: Add a Date Criteria to the "Exception" Rule

What if I need to also set a date for the student(s) who can access the lesson before the rest of the class? No problem! This can be done by adding a second criteria to the "Exception" rule.
  1. Click the module's action link
  2. Click Adaptive Release: Advanced
  3. Hover over the name of the "Exception" rule. An action link will appear. Click the action link, then Edit criteria
  4. Create Criteria -> Date
  5. Check the Display After box and customize the date and time for the module to open for the student(s) being granted early access to the module.
  6. Click Submit
